Product reviews:
Tab
2025-09-13 iphone 7 Plus
Giant Large Huge Big Blue /Green /Pink giant green stuffed dinosaur
giant green stuffed dinosaur
Giant Sitting Tyrannosaurus Plush Toy giant green stuffed dinosaur
giant green stuffed dinosaur
Myron
2025-09-17 iphone 11 Pro Max
Dinosaur plush toy giant green stuffed dinosaur
giant green stuffed dinosaur
Gustave
2025-09-22 iphone XS Max
Doll 200cm|giant stuffed plush|doll giant green stuffed dinosaur
giant green stuffed dinosaur